Teacher Type #5 – The Hybrid Teacher. These types of teachers are the experts at blending. He or she blends different curriculum-appropriate teaching styles that integrate a teacher’s interest and personality with that of the students. Since it is inclusive, this approach is highly effective.

A demonstration lesson is a planned lesson taught to an interview committee or a group of students to assess your teaching abilities and skills. The process can vary depending on the school: You may be directed to teach a specific topic or a particular skill; or, you may be able to teach a lesson entirely of your own choosing. Teaching styles can be categorized into four categories: formal authority, demonstrator, facilitator, and delegator.¹ Teachers who have a formal authority teaching style tend to focus on content. The teacher feels responsible for providing and controlling the flow of content.

Teachers who have a demonstrator or personal model teaching style tend to run teacher-centred classes with an emphasis on demonstration and modeling.
